Need to get my microscope to magnify 200x on Linux computer

I have a USB 2.0 Digital Microscope. On my Linux Mint computer system, it works fine, but does NOT magnify to the 200x. Only seems to magnify to 50x. Does anyone know how I can get the 200x digital magnification to work on Linux??? thank you so much.

Hello Susan,

Actually, since you cannot use the included software on Linux, you can’t change the capture resolution so there’s no digital magnification.

You can still get some fairly good results though. If you’re only able to magnify to near the ~50x indicated mark on the microscope, try this:

Put the clear shield right up against an object you want to magnify. At this point, you should have a lower magnification focal point at around 35x. If you continue moving the zoom wheel to around the 200x mark, you should have another clear focal point. Many people miss this second focal point, it’s part of the normal behavior with the varifocal lens.

The actual magnification is going to depend on the distance from the microscope to the object, and the size of the monitor.
